深入学习PL/SQL编程: Cibertec课程指南

需积分: 5 0 下载量 24 浏览量 更新于2024-12-16 收藏 192KB ZIP 举报
资源摘要信息:"PL/SQL课程是Cibertec机构开设的一门专业课程,专注于教授PL/SQL编程语言。PL/SQL是Oracle数据库的扩展,用于处理数据库事务,它是一种过程化语言,允许存储过程和函数的编写,以对Oracle数据库进行更有效的控制和操作。该课程由经验丰富的讲师罗伯托·华曼(roberto.huaman@gmail.com)授课,旨在帮助学生掌握PL/SQL的基础知识和高级技术,以便在实际的工作环境中能够高效地使用PL/SQL。 在学习这门课程的过程中,学员将了解PL/SQL的基本概念,包括程序结构、数据类型、控制语句、错误处理等。此外,课程将深入探讨PL/SQL块的编写和调试,以及如何在Oracle数据库中使用SQL Developer或SQL*Plus等工具来执行PL/SQL程序。学员还将学习如何创建和管理存储过程、函数、触发器和包等数据库对象,这些都是PL/SQL的核心组成部分。 通过实践项目和实例,学员将获得编写高效、优化的PL/SQL代码的实战经验。课程内容可能还包括但不限于如下几个方面: - PL/SQL程序结构:包括匿名块和命名块的概念及其结构。 - 变量声明和数据类型:学习如何在PL/SQL中声明变量、常量和使用不同的数据类型。 - 控制流程:掌握条件语句(IF、CASE)和循环语句(FOR、WHILE、LOOP)的使用。 - 异常处理:学习如何使用异常处理机制来处理运行时错误。 - 事务管理:了解事务的概念以及如何在PL/SQL中进行事务控制。 - 存储过程和函数:学习创建、修改、执行以及调试存储过程和函数。 - 触发器:了解触发器的工作原理以及如何开发数据库触发器。 - 包:掌握如何创建和管理PL/SQL包。 - 性能优化:学习编写高效PL/SQL代码和优化数据库访问的方法。 掌握PL/SQL是数据库管理员(DBA)、开发人员以及任何希望在数据库领域内深化其技能的专业人士不可或缺的一部分。通过这门课程,学员将能够在使用Oracle数据库的组织中发挥关键作用,特别是在需要进行复杂的数据库编程和维护任务时。"